The Quick Answer: Average Annual Salary for a Forensic Scientist in the US

The question of “how much do forensic scientists make” has a compelling, data-driven answer. As of the most recent reporting, the median annual salary for a Forensic Scientist (or Forensic Science Technician, as officially classified) in the United States is approximately $67,440. This figure, provided by the U.S. Bureau of Labor Statistics (BLS) and based on 2024 data, represents the midpoint of the entire field’s pay scale. However, the earning potential rises sharply with experience and specialization: top earners, often senior specialists, expert witnesses, or laboratory managers, can comfortably make over $110,000 annually. This significant earning ceiling demonstrates the high value placed on seasoned expertise and specialized knowledge within the criminal justice system.

The Core Factors That Determine a Forensic Scientist’s Pay

A forensic scientist’s salary is not a single, fixed number; it is a dynamic figure shaped by a distinct set of professional attributes. While specialization and location play a significant role, the two most reliable indicators of earning potential are the individual’s level of experience and their academic credentials.

Experience Level: Entry-Level vs. Senior Expert Pay Ranges

The transition from a novice analyst to a seasoned expert brings substantial and measurable increases in compensation. For entry-level Forensic Scientists with zero to two years of experience, the typical starting range falls between approximately $45,560 and $53,310 annually. This data aligns with the 10th and 25th percentile earnings reported by the U.S. Bureau of Labor Statistics (BLS) for Forensic Science Technicians, reflecting starting roles that often involve basic evidence processing and analysis under supervision.

As your career advances, your value—and corresponding pay—rises. In the government sector, which employs the majority of forensic scientists, this progression is transparently laid out by the Federal General Schedule (GS) Pay Scale. New forensic scientists with a Bachelor’s degree often start at a GS-7 grade, which has a base salary range of roughly $42,679 to $55,486 (based on 2025 GS pay tables for the Rest of U.S. locality). A Senior Specialist or Technical Leader with over a decade of experience and a track record of reliable, high-quality work and court testimony could easily qualify for a GS-12 grade, which commands a base salary range starting around $75,706 to $98,422. This clear, published structure demonstrates unequivocally how experience and demonstrated competence translate directly into higher federal pay grades.

Education and Certifications: The Pay Bump for Advanced Degrees and Credentials

Academic achievement is one of the most reliable ways to increase your earning potential in the forensic sciences. While a Bachelor’s degree is the standard minimum requirement, pursuing a Master’s or Doctoral degree can increase a professional’s starting salary by 15% to 25%. For example, while a Bachelor’s-level hire might start at the GS-7 level, a candidate with a Master’s degree is often eligible to enter the federal system at the higher GS-9 level, skipping years of lower pay.

Advanced degrees are also critical because they are frequently required for the highest-paying supervisory or expert witness roles. Credibility is everything in the forensic field, and an advanced degree, coupled with a history of peer-reviewed publications and court experience, establishes the authority and knowledge necessary to command top-tier compensation—a key component of superior professional standing.

Forensic Specialization Salary Deep Dive: Where the Money is Made

In forensic science, your specialization is the single most important factor determining your earning potential. The extensive education, specialized certification, and technical expertise required for certain sub-fields dramatically shift compensation beyond the median $67,440 salary reported for forensic science technicians by the U.S. Bureau of Labor Statistics (BLS).

High-Earning Roles: Forensic Pathologists, Digital Forensics, and Engineers

The highest salaries in the forensic field are reserved for those who hold dual expertise or extensive medical credentials.

Forensic Pathologists stand at the top of the pay scale. These professionals are licensed medical doctors (MD or DO) who have completed a four-year pathology residency and a one-year forensic pathology fellowship. Due to this extensive medical education—a minimum of 12 years of post-secondary training—and the critical nature of their work (determining cause and manner of death), their salaries often exceed $200,000 annually, with top earners in high-demand metropolitan areas or private consultancies making over $300,000.

Another area that commands six-figure salaries is Digital Forensics. This specialization is a rapidly growing field with an escalating demand driven by the ubiquity of digital devices in criminal activity. Senior Digital Forensics Examiners who possess advanced computer science expertise and high-value certifications (like a Certified Forensic Examiner or CFCE) can command salaries in the $110,000 to $140,000 range. This level of compensation is reflective of the unique, cross-disciplinary technical skills required to recover, analyze, and present complex digital evidence in court, often in high-stakes cybercrime or corporate investigations.

The Pay Scale for DNA Analysts, Toxicologists, and Ballistics Experts

The majority of working laboratory scientists fall into core analysis specializations. While their salaries may not reach the heights of forensic pathologists, they represent a strong, well-compensated career path with excellent job stability.

Forensic Specialization Typical Median Annual Salary* Key Education/Experience
Forensic Pathologist >$219,000 MD/DO + Residency/Fellowship
Digital Forensics Examiner $90,000 - $110,000 Bachelor’s/Master’s in Computer Science + Certification
Forensic Toxicologist $65,000 - $92,000 Bachelor’s/Master’s in Chemistry/Toxicology
Forensic DNA Analyst $61,000 - $85,000 Bachelor’s in Biology/Chemistry + Specialized DNA Training
Forensic Science Technician $67,440 Bachelor’s Degree

*Data compiled from the U.S. Bureau of Labor Statistics (BLS, May 2024 data for Forensic Science Technicians) and professional salary aggregators for specialized roles.

As seen in the data above, the pay for a Forensic DNA Analyst or a Forensic Toxicologist reflects their critical role in the justice system. Toxicologists, who test biological samples for drugs and poisons, and DNA Analysts, who interpret complex genetic profiles, require specific, rigorous analytical training and quality assurance expertise. To establish credibility and earn higher pay grades, many professionals pursue certification from bodies like the American Board of Criminalistics (ABC), which validates their technical competency to a high professional standard.

Comparing Forensic Technician vs. Forensic Scientist Pay

It is important to distinguish between the title of a Forensic Science Technician and a specialized Forensic Scientist/Analyst. The BLS data, which serves as the most reliable national benchmark, primarily tracks the Forensic Science Technician occupation, reporting a median annual salary of $67,440.

A Forensic Science Technician role often involves crime scene processing, evidence collection, and preliminary laboratory duties. While a Bachelor’s degree is typically the minimum requirement, this role usually functions as a starting point. A dedicated Forensic Scientist or Forensic Analyst—such as a tenured DNA analyst or Toxicologist—typically specializes in one laboratory discipline, performs highly complex technical analysis, and provides expert witness testimony. These specialized roles are often found at the upper end of the Forensic Science Technician pay range (the 90th percentile often exceeds $110,710) or, in the case of federal employment, fall under higher government pay grades (like GS-12 and above). The key to maximizing your income is moving beyond the general technician role and into a specialized, credentialed analyst or medical position.

Geographic Salary Variation: Highest Paying States and Metro Areas

The location of a forensic scientist’s employment is one of the most significant variables in determining their total compensation. States and metropolitan areas with a higher demand for services, a greater density of specialized private labs, or a higher cost of living will naturally offer higher salaries.

Top 5 Highest Paying States for Forensic Scientists (BLS Data)

While the mean annual salary for a forensic scientist in the U.S. hovers around the mid-$70,000s, certain states offer compensation that dramatically exceeds this figure. The U.S. Bureau of Labor Statistics (BLS) data consistently points to a handful of states as having the highest mean wages. For example, states like Illinois, California, and New York frequently report the highest mean salaries, often pushing well into the $80,000 to $100,000 range. Illinois, in particular, has reported a mean annual wage exceeding $$106,000$, while California maintains the highest total employment, offering a wealth of opportunities alongside high pay.

This pattern is even more pronounced at the metropolitan level. Major urban centers, particularly on the West Coast, are magnets for high salaries. For example, metro areas such as San Jose-Sunnyvale-Santa Clara, CA, and San Francisco-Oakland-Fremont, CA, push the mean annual pay for forensic science professionals well over $$95,000$ and, in some cases, over $$125,000$, according to recent BLS and salary surveys. This higher pay reflects the region’s strong investment in technology and dense population centers requiring extensive forensic services.

The Cost-of-Living Factor: Adjusting High Salaries for Real-World Value

The allure of a six-figure salary in a major city must be balanced against the true purchasing power of that income. The nominal salary is the figure on your paycheck, but the real adjusted salary accounts for the cost of living (COL) in that area.

To fully understand your potential compensation, consider the difference between a high-pay, high-COL state like California and a lower-pay, lower-COL state like Texas. According to 2024 data, a forensic scientist in California might earn a mean annual wage of approximately $$99,390$. By contrast, a forensic scientist in Texas might earn a mean annual wage of approximately $$60,730$. While the California salary is nominally $$38,660$ higher, the cost of living in major California metro areas can be over 50% higher than in Texas metro areas. This means a $$60,730$ salary in a lower-cost area could afford a comparable, or even better, quality of life and savings rate than a nearly six-figure salary in a prohibitively expensive coastal city. Candidates must incorporate credible cost-of-living indices into their decision-making to accurately gauge a job offer’s value.

Understanding Government Employment vs. Private Sector Pay by Region

The type of employer also shifts the importance of local economic factors. Most forensic scientists work for state and local government agencies (e.g., State Police, County Crime Labs). These government jobs, while offering strong benefits and reliable pension plans, tend to adhere to rigid pay scales that are heavily influenced by local government budgets and tax bases.

Conversely, federal positions (like those with the FBI, DEA, or ATF) operate under the General Schedule (GS) pay scale. This scale is uniform across the country but includes a “locality pay adjustment” based on the cost of labor in a specific metropolitan area. This mechanism ensures that a federal forensic scientist in a high-cost area receives a substantial pay bump, making federal jobs highly competitive and less reliant on the fiscal health of the local county or state. Private sector jobs, typically found in large corporations, independent DNA labs, or consulting firms, offer the greatest potential for high-end negotiation and bonuses, especially in rapidly growing, high-value specializations like digital forensics, and they are generally concentrated in major metro hubs.

Strategies to Increase Your Forensic Scientist Earning Potential

While the forensic science field offers strong job security, maximizing your salary requires a strategic approach that goes beyond simply putting in time. The greatest gains in compensation are realized by intentionally cultivating expertise, authority, and professional trust—the key elements that qualify you for senior and managerial pay grades.

Negotiation Tactics for Your First and Subsequent Job Offers

Salary negotiation in the public sector, where most forensic scientists are employed, can be rigid, but it is rarely impossible. For positions governed by the Federal General Schedule (GS) pay system or similar state structures, while the range may be fixed, you can often negotiate your starting step or grade based on relevant prior experience, a master’s degree, or professional certifications.

A proven negotiation strategy is to strategically leverage competitive offers. If a private laboratory or consulting firm offers a significantly higher nominal salary (even if the benefits are less comprehensive), you can use this offer to push a government agency to place you higher on their established pay scale. Given the high demand for forensic specialists, this tactic demonstrates your market value and can result in you starting at a GS-9 or GS-11 grade rather than a GS-7, translating to tens of thousands of dollars in cumulative pay over your career. Always focus on the total compensation package, including vacation time, retirement matching, and long-term promotional potential.

Pursuing High-Value Certifications (e.g., ABC, CFE) and Continuing Education

Nothing signals a higher level of professional proficiency and authority like specialized, board-certified credentials. Earning certification from the American Board of Criminalistics (ABC) can be a key factor in qualifying for higher pay grades and senior specialist roles. Certification in specific areas (like Drug Analysis, DNA, or Fire Debris Analysis) demonstrates an advanced level of subject matter mastery that employers, especially those seeking expert witness testimony, are willing to pay a premium for. Furthermore, in rapidly evolving fields such as Digital Forensics, credentials like the Certified Fraud Examiner (CFE) or specialized vendor certifications are crucial for commanding the highest salaries, as they validate your ability to handle cutting-edge technology and complex, high-stakes investigations. Continuing education, even if informal, is vital to maintaining this competitive edge.

The Career Path to Management and Laboratory Director Roles

For forensic scientists aiming for the top of the pay scale, the goal must transition from technical excellence to executive leadership. Management positions, such as Lab Director, Chief Toxicologist, or Quality Assurance Manager, represent the highest compensation tiers, often pushing annual earnings well over the six-figure mark. These roles typically require 10 or more years of hands-on technical experience plus demonstrated leadership skills, including budget management, policy development, and team oversight.

The transition from scientist to director is a significant shift in responsibility. Career Outlook and Job Growth Projections for Forensic Science

Understanding the long-term job market is crucial when evaluating the ultimate earning potential in any career. The forensic science field is not just stable—it is poised for significant expansion, driven by continuous advances in technology and a growing reliance on objective scientific evidence in the legal system.

Forecasting Demand: Projected Job Growth Through 2034

The career trajectory for those in forensic science is highly optimistic. The U.S. Bureau of Labor Statistics (BLS) projects a job growth rate of 13% for Forensic Science Technicians through 2034, a pace considered much faster than the average for all occupations. This high demand is directly tied to the increasing volume of forensic evidence being collected and the complexity of modern criminal cases, which require specialized analysis. This projected increase suggests a healthy job market with approximately 2,900 annual openings, a strong indication of career longevity and reliable employment.

The greatest concentration of this new demand is anticipated in the public sector. State and local government agencies—specifically crime labs and medical examiners’ offices—are expected to lead the hiring surge. While these government roles often offer a lower mean starting salary compared to high-end private sector positions, they typically compensate through robust and predictable government-backed pension plans, excellent health and dental benefits, and a locality-based pay scale that provides financial stability and a strong benefits package.

Your Top Questions About Forensic Scientist Pay Answered

Q1. Is being a forensic scientist a high-paying job?

The compensation for a forensic scientist is generally well above the national average, but it may not be considered “high-paying” when compared to other professions that require a similar level of rigorous scientific education, such as a petroleum engineer or a physician. Based on 2024 data from the U.S. Bureau of Labor Statistics (BLS), the median annual salary for a Forensic Science Technician (the classification that includes most forensic scientists) is $$67,440$. This comfortably places the profession in the upper middle class. However, top earners—often senior specialists, federal employees (like those at the FBI, who may earn over $$120,000$), or laboratory directors—regularly exceed $$110,000$ annually, demonstrating strong career ceiling potential for those who develop specialized expertise and advance into management.

Q2. What is the typical starting salary for an entry-level forensic scientist?

The typical starting salary for an entry-level forensic scientist with a Bachelor’s degree falls within the range of $$45,000$ to $$55,000$. This figure represents the 10th to 25th percentile of earnings in the field, according to BLS data. Crucially, the starting pay depends heavily on the employer. A local or state government crime lab may offer a starting wage closer to the lower end of this range, while a federal government position (often starting at a GS-7 or GS-9 level) or a specialized private laboratory in a high-cost-of-living area will typically offer a significantly higher starting package.

Q3. Which specialization in forensic science pays the most?

The highest-paying roles in forensic science are almost universally tied to those requiring the most extensive, highly specialized education and training. Forensic Pathologists command the highest salaries, often ranging from $$200,000$ to over $$400,000$, due to the requirement of a Medical Doctor (MD) degree plus extensive residency and fellowship training. Outside of the medical field, Digital Forensics Examiners and Forensic Engineers are among the top earners. Senior Digital Forensics professionals, who require advanced computer science expertise and in-demand certifications, frequently earn between $$110,000$ and $$140,000$, reflecting the urgent demand for expertise in complex cybercrime cases.

Q4. How does a forensic scientist’s salary compare to a crime scene investigator (CSI)?

The salary comparison often depends on how the job titles are defined, as roles and responsibilities vary by jurisdiction. Generally, the job title “Crime Scene Investigator” (CSI) or “Crime Scene Technician” most closely aligns with the BLS category of “Forensic Science Technician.” These field-based roles, primarily focused on evidence collection and scene documentation, typically have a median salary that is the same or slightly lower than specialized laboratory-based Forensic Scientists (like DNA Analysts or Toxicologists). While many professionals move between these roles, a degreed Forensic Scientist working as an expert witness in a niche lab specialization often has a higher long-term earning ceiling than a general Forensic Science Technician focused solely on the crime scene.
